Targeting a novel alternative nuclear factor kappa B (NF-kB) axis in an osteosarcoma cell line

Description

The canonical and non-canonical NF-κB signalling pathways are well established to an extent. However, this project focuses on expanding that knowledge by investigating the intermediates involved in IKKα-dependent signalling mediated by IL-1β stimulation (a canonical NF-κB ligand), resulting in non-canonical NFκB2 (p100) phosphorylation. Additionally, this project aims to investigate the consequences of IL-1β-mediated IKKα signalling on expression of pro-inflammatory genes.
